What is a Car Key Locksmith?

A car key locksmith is a specialized professional trained in dealing with a wide range of car key and lock-related problems. Unlike standard locksmith professionals who work on residential or business locks, car key locksmith professionals focus on vehicle-related tasks. Their skillset enables them to deal with modern-day electronic key systems, traditional metal keys, and even advanced keyless entry systems.

Key services offered by locksmith car key specialists consist of:

  • Key duplication
  • Key replacement
  • Key repair
  • Ignition repair
  • Transponder key programming
  • Emergency lockout help

Why You Might Need a Car Key Locksmith

There are many situations where employing an expert locksmith for your car keys becomes necessary. Here are some of the most common scenarios:

1. Lost or Stolen Keys

Losing your car keys or having them stolen is among the most aggravating and stressful experiences. Without your keys, your vehicle becomes unattainable. A locksmith can cut a new set of keys and reprogram your car's key system to ensure the old keys no longer work, offering increased security.

2. Harmed or Broken Keys

Car keys can get worn out gradually or break in the lock or ignition. A locksmith can repair the damage or craft a replacement, restoring your access to your vehicle.

3. Locked Out of Your Car

Getting locked out of your vehicle can happen to anyone and frequently happens at the most bothersome times. An expert locksmith can rapidly unlock your vehicle without triggering damage, allowing you to return on the roadway.

4. Faulty Ignition or Locks

In some cases, the problem isn't with the key but with the ignition system or door locks. A car key locksmith can identify the issue and repair or replace the malfunctioning parts with precision.

5. Required for a Spare Key

Car owners often overlook the value of having a spare set of keys. A locksmith can duplicate your keys, so you're prepared in case of an emergency situation.


Types of Car Key Services Offered by Locksmiths

Modern locksmiths are equipped with tools and technology to manage a wide range of key-related services. Here's a more detailed take a look at their key areas of expertise:

1. Traditional Key Cutting

For older vehicles or those using metal keys, locksmiths can duplicate or replace keys using accuracy cutting tools.

2. Transponder Key Programming

Transponder keys have a chip that interacts with your car's onboard computer to begin the engine. If this chip is harmed or lost, a locksmith can program new keys to match your car.

3. Proximity and Keyless Entry Systems

Proximity keys and keyless entry systems are ending up being significantly typical, especially in state-of-the-art automobiles. A locksmith can repair, reprogram, or replace these innovative systems.

4. Smart Key Repair or Replacement

Smart keys, which allow you to unlock, start, and control your car remotely, can establish technical issues. Specialized locksmith professionals can replace or reprogram these innovative keys.

Frequently Asked Questions About Locksmith Car Key Services

1. Just how much does it cost to replace a car key?

The cost of replacing a car key varies depending on the key type. Standard metal keys are normally more economical than transponder or clever keys, which need programming. Costs typically vary from ₤ 50 to ₤ 300 but can be higher for high-end lorries.

2. Can a locksmith make a key without the initial?

Yes. An experienced locksmith can produce a new key even if you don't have the original by utilizing the car's VIN number and other technical approaches.

3. Are locksmith services for vehicles covered by insurance?

In lots of cases, car insurance coverage may cover locksmith services, especially for emergency situations. Contact your service provider to learn if it's consisted of in your policy.

4. How long does it take to replace a car key?

The time required depends on the key type. A conventional key might take just a few minutes, while transponder and clever keys might use up to an hour due to programming needs.

5. What should I do if my key breaks in the ignition?

If your key breaks in the ignition, prevent trying to eliminate it yourself considering that this may trigger additional damage. Call a locksmith who can safely extract the broken key and repair or replace the ignition as needed.
